+ ### withCostTracking() — budget limits
- ## Expected implementation output
+ ```ts
+ .withCostTracking()
+ // Enables cost tracking with defaults:
+ // perRequest: $1.00, perSession: $5.00, daily: $20.00, monthly: $200.00
- - Builder chain with `.withCostTracking()` and complementary verification/observability.
- - Policy configuration covering per-task and daily/monthly ceilings.
- - Runtime behavior that degrades gracefully before hard failure.
+ .withCostTracking({
+ perRequest: 0.50, // hard stop mid-request if cost would exceed this
+ perSession: 5.0,
+ daily: 20.0,
+ monthly: 200.0,
+ })
+ ```
- ## Code Examples
+ When a budget is exceeded, the agent throws a `BudgetExceededError` and stops. Daily/monthly budgets reset based on the timezone configured in `.withGateway()` (if used) or UTC by default.

+ ### withRateLimiting() — throughput caps
- To track token usage and estimate costs, use the `.withCostTracking()` builder method. The cost and token count will be available in the `metadata` of the result object.
+ ```ts
+ .withRateLimiting()
+ // Defaults: 60 RPM, 100,000 TPM, 10 concurrent requests
- ```typescript
- import { ReactiveAgents } from "@reactive-agents/runtime";
- import { openRouterPricingProvider } from "@reactive-agents/llm-provider";
+ .withRateLimiting({
+ requestsPerMinute: 60, // max LLM requests per minute
+ tokensPerMinute: 100_000, // max tokens per minute (input + output)
+ maxConcurrent: 10, // max simultaneous in-flight LLM requests
+ })
+ ```
- const agent = await ReactiveAgents.create()
- .withName("cost-tracked-agent")
- .withProvider("anthropic")
- // Enable cost tracking
- .withCostTracking()
- // Ensure prices are always accurate
- .withDynamicPricing(openRouterPricingProvider)
- .build();
+ Requests that exceed limits are queued (not dropped) — the agent waits for capacity before proceeding.
- const result = await agent.run("What is the capital of France?");
+ ### withCircuitBreaker() — provider reliability
- const cost = result.metadata.cost ?? 0;
- const tokens = result.metadata.tokensUsed ?? 0;
+ ```ts
+ .withCircuitBreaker()
+ // Default thresholds (open after 5 failures in 60s window, retry after 30s)
- console.log(`Output: ${result.output}`);
- console.log(`Tokens used: ${tokens}`);
- console.log(`Estimated cost: $${cost.toFixed(6)}`);
+ .withCircuitBreaker({
+ failureThreshold: 5, // open circuit after N consecutive failures
+ windowMs: 60_000, // failure counting window
+ retryAfterMs: 30_000, // wait before trying half-open probe
+ })
```
- ### Daily Token Budget via Gateway Policies
-
- For persistent agents with daily token caps, use the gateway's built-in policy engine. It tracks token usage via the EventBus and emits a `BudgetExhausted` event when the daily limit is hit.
+ Circuit breaker states: `closed` (normal) → `open` (failing fast) → `half-open` (probing recovery).

+ ## CostTrackingOptions reference
- const result = await agent.run(prompt);
- const runCost = result.metadata.cost ?? 0;
- totalCost += runCost;
+ | Field | Type | Default | Notes |
+ |-------|------|---------|-------|
+ | `perRequest` | `number` | `1.00` | Max USD per single LLM request |
+ | `perSession` | `number` | `5.00` | Max USD per `agent.run()` call |
+ | `daily` | `number` | `20.00` | Max USD per calendar day |
+ | `monthly` | `number` | `200.00` | Max USD per calendar month |
- console.log(`Run cost: $${runCost.toFixed(6)}, Total: $${totalCost.toFixed(6)}`);
- return result;
- }
- ```
+ ## RateLimiterConfig reference
- ## Pitfalls to avoid
+ | Field | Type | Default | Notes |
+ |-------|------|---------|-------|
+ | `requestsPerMinute` | `number` | `60` | Max LLM requests/minute |
+ | `tokensPerMinute` | `number` | `100_000` | Max tokens/minute (input + output) |
+ | `maxConcurrent` | `number` | `10` | Max simultaneous in-flight requests |

+ ## Pitfalls
+
+ - Budget limits are enforced per-process — multiple processes running the same agent each get their own daily/monthly counters; use an external store for true cross-process budget tracking
+ - `withCostTracking()` with no args is still useful — it enables cost telemetry without enforcing limits (all defaults are generous)
+ - `withCircuitBreaker()` opens on LLM provider errors, not on budget exceeded errors — they are independent systems
+ - Rate limiting queues requests rather than dropping them — set `maxConcurrent` based on your provider's actual concurrency limits to avoid provider-side 429s
+ - `withDynamicPricing()` makes an external HTTP call during build — ensure network access and handle build failures
+ - Daily budget resets at midnight UTC by default — to use a different timezone, configure it via `.withGateway({ timezone: "America/New_York" })`
